How to use people from other groups instead of showing members of Confluence user group in "People" on Confluence title bar. Also, how to show all the users, thanks.

To search for a particular person, type their first name and/or the last name into the search box and choose Search. Please do not forget the people directory does not include users who can log into Confluence using external user management if they have never yet logged in. 

To see everyone who uses your Confluence site, you can choose All People.

May I ask whether users synchronized from JIRA can be displayed? Thank you.

If you are using Jira as a user directory for Confluence, you can only view the users on the Confluence People page who logged into Confluence at least once. You can not view other users who never logged into Confluence. 

P.S: Please do not forget Jira users need to be added to either the confluence-users or confluence-administrators group on Jira to be able to login to Confluence.
